FlutterFlow is a leading visual development platform that revolutionizes the way teams create, design, and deploy applications. With over 2M users across 200+ countries, FlutterFlow enables teams to build apps without extensive coding knowledge. With an intuitive visual interface, granular control over app experience and cross-platform deployment capabilities, FlutterFlow is trusted by startups and Fortune 500 companies alike to accelerate their product development and deliver innovative digital solutions quickly and efficiently.

About the Role

We are looking for a Product Designer who is excited about shaping the future of application development. In this role, you’ll work closely with our founders, engineers, and the broader team to craft intuitive, powerful, and scalable experiences for FlutterFlow users. You’ll be instrumental in defining not just what we build next, but how it looks, feels, and functions.

You are not just polishing interfaces — you are helping design a complex platform that makes professional-grade app creation accessible to everyone.

What You Will Work On

  • Partner with founders, product, and engineering teams to identify, prioritize, and design new features that empower users.

  • Lead the design of critical experiences — from new widgets and integrations to improving our code generation UX.

  • Help evolve and scale our design system to ensure consistency, efficiency, and scalability across the platform.

  • Work closely with users to gather insights, validate design decisions, and iterate rapidly.

  • Create high-fidelity prototypes to communicate ideas, test hypotheses, and refine interactions.

  • Collaborate with engineers to ensure feasibility and pixel-perfect implementation.

  • Raise the bar for UX quality across the entire FlutterFlow platform.

Who You Are

  • 5+ years of end-to-end product design experience, ideally within fast-paced startups or product-driven environments.

  • Able to demonstrate a portfolio of released products that simplified complex workflows for internal or developer users.

  • Relentless focus on understanding users' needs and advocating for the best experience possible, particularly for technical products

  • Skilled at working closely with engineering teams to bring products to life, including a  nuanced understanding of the development process

  • Thrive in ambiguity and love helping define both the problem and the solution.

  • Deep attention to detail — from polished interfaces to thoughtful microinteractions.

  • You are excited to collaborate across global teams and are willing to travel for quarterly team summits, including occasional international trips.

  • Located in North American or Western European timezones

Bonus Points 

  • Experience designing for developers: platforms, IDEs, or technical products. 

  • Fluency in prototyping tools (Figma, Framer, Protopie, etc.)

  • Basic understanding of Flutter or code-based systems.

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
